Changes for page 13 Structure Mapping

Last modified by Helena on 2025/09/10 11:19

From version 10.2
edited by Helena
on 2025/05/16 09:10
Change comment: There is no comment for this version
To version 3.1
edited by Helena
on 2025/05/15 15:48
Change comment: There is no comment for this version

Summary

Details

Page properties
Content
... ... @@ -1,6 +1,4 @@
1 -{{box title="**Contents**"}}
2 -{{toc/}}
3 -{{/box}}
1 += 13 Structure Mapping =
4 4  
5 5  == 13.1 Introduction ==
6 6  
... ... @@ -18,7 +18,7 @@
18 18  
19 19  * Transforming received data into a common internal structure;
20 20  * Transforming reported data into the data collector's preferred structure;
21 -* Transforming unidimensional datasets^^[[(% class="wikiinternallink wikiinternallink" %)^^43^^>>path:#sdfootnote43sym||name="sdfootnote43anc"]](%%)^^ to multi-dimensional; and
19 +* Transforming unidimensional datasets^^[[^^43^^>>path:#sdfootnote43sym||name="sdfootnote43anc"]]^^ to multi-dimensional; and
22 22  * Transforming internal datasets with a complex structure to a simpler structure with fewer dimensions suitable for dissemination.
23 23  
24 24  == 13.2 1-1 structure maps ==
... ... @@ -33,7 +33,7 @@
33 33  |Algeria|DZ|DZA
34 34  |American Samoa|AS|ASM
35 35  |Andorra|AD|AND
36 -|etc…| |
34 +|etc…||
37 37  
38 38  Different source values can also map to the same target value, for example when deriving regions from country codes.
39 39  
... ... @@ -158,7 +158,7 @@
158 158  |DZ|DZA
159 159  |AS|ASM
160 160  |AD|AND
161 -|etc…|
159 +|etc…|
162 162  
163 163  A Representation Map mapping free text country names to an ISO 2-character Codelist could be similarly described:
164 164  
... ... @@ -169,7 +169,7 @@
169 169  |"Great Britain"|GB
170 170  |"Ireland"|IE
171 171  |"Eire"|IE
172 -|etc…|
170 +|etc…|
173 173  
174 174  Valuelists, introduced in SDMX 3.0, are equivalent to Codelists but allow the maintenance of non-SDMX identifiers. Importantly, their IDs do not need to conform to IDType, but as a consequence are not Identifiable.
175 175  
... ... @@ -180,7 +180,7 @@
180 180  |Value|Locale|Name
181 181  |$|en|United States Dollar
182 182  |%|En|Percentage
183 -| |fr|Pourcentage
181 +||fr|Pourcentage
184 184  
185 185  Other characteristics of Representation Maps:
186 186  
... ... @@ -279,7 +279,7 @@
279 279  
280 280  Date and time formats are specified by date and time pattern strings based on Java's Simple Date Format. Within date and time pattern strings, unquoted letters from 'A' to 'Z' and from 'a' to 'z' are interpreted as pattern letters representing the components of a date or time string. Text can be quoted using single quotes (') to avoid interpretation. "''" represents a single quote. All other characters are not interpreted; they're simply copied into the output string during formatting or matched against the input string during parsing.
281 281  
282 -Due to the fact that dates may differ per locale, an optional property, defining the locale of the pattern, is provided. This would assist processing of source dates, according to the given locale^^[[(% class="wikiinternallink wikiinternallink" %)^^44^^>>path:#sdfootnote44sym||name="sdfootnote44anc"]](%%)^^. An indicative list of examples is presented in the following table:
280 +Due to the fact that dates may differ per locale, an optional property, defining the locale of the pattern, is provided. This would assist processing of source dates, according to the given locale^^[[^^44^^>>path:#sdfootnote44sym||name="sdfootnote44anc"]]^^. An indicative list of examples is presented in the following table:
283 283  
284 284  |English (en)|Australia (AU)|en-AU
285 285  |English (en)|Canada (CA)|en-CA
... ... @@ -325,7 +325,7 @@
325 325  
326 326  |Letter|Date or Time Component|Presentation|Examples
327 327  |G|Era designator|[[Text>>url:https://docs.oracle.com/javase/7/docs/api/java/text/SimpleDateFormat.html#text]][[url:https://docs.oracle.com/javase/7/docs/api/java/text/SimpleDateFormat.html#text]]|AD
328 -|yy|Year short (upper case is Year of Week^^[[(% class="wikiinternallink wikiinternallink" %)^^45^^>>path:#sdfootnote45sym||name="sdfootnote45anc"]](%%)^^)|[[Year>>url:https://docs.oracle.com/javase/7/docs/api/java/text/SimpleDateFormat.html#year]][[url:https://docs.oracle.com/javase/7/docs/api/java/text/SimpleDateFormat.html#year]]|96
326 +|yy|Year short (upper case is Year of Week^^[[^^45^^>>path:#sdfootnote45sym||name="sdfootnote45anc"]]^^)|[[Year>>url:https://docs.oracle.com/javase/7/docs/api/java/text/SimpleDateFormat.html#year]][[url:https://docs.oracle.com/javase/7/docs/api/java/text/SimpleDateFormat.html#year]]|96
329 329  |yyyy|Year Full (upper case is Year of Week)|Year|1996
330 330  |MM|Month number in year starting with 1|Month|07
331 331  |MMM|Month name short|Month|Jul
... ... @@ -530,7 +530,7 @@
530 530  
531 531  The following representation mapping can be used to explicitly map each age to an output code.
532 532  
533 -:
531 +:
534 534  
535 535  (((
536 536  |Source Input Free Text|Desired Output Code Id
... ... @@ -547,7 +547,7 @@
547 547  
548 548  __Regular Expression __Desired Output
549 549  
550 -:
548 +:
551 551  
552 552  (((
553 553  |[0-2]|A
... ... @@ -558,7 +558,7 @@
558 558  
559 559  This use case is where a specific observation for a specific time period has an attribute 3468 value.
560 560  
561 -:
559 +:
562 562  
563 563  (((
564 564  |Input INDICATOR|Input TIME_PERIOD|Output OBS_CONF
... ... @@ -579,7 +579,7 @@
579 579  
580 580  The Component Mapping from SYS_TIME to TIME_PERIOD specifies itself as a time mapping with the following details:
581 581  
582 -:
580 +:
583 583  
584 584  (((
585 585  |Source Value|Source Mapping|Target Frequency|Output
... ... @@ -590,18 +590,18 @@
590 590  
591 591  [[image:SDMX 3-0-0 SECTION 6 FINAL-1.0_en_dbe68698.gif||alt="Shape12" height="1" width="273"]]
592 592  
593 -:
594 -::
591 +:
592 +::
595 595  
596 596  (((
597 597  |Source Value|Source Mapping|Target Frequency Output Dimension
598 598  
599 -|18/07/1981 dd/MM/yyyy|FREQ| |1981-07-18 (when FREQ=D)
597 +|18/07/1981 dd/MM/yyyy|FREQ||1981-07-18 (when FREQ=D)
600 600  |(% rowspan="2" %)(((
601 601  __When the source is a numerical form__at
602 602  
603 603  Source Value Start Period Interv
604 -)))| | |
602 +)))|||
605 605  |al|(((
606 606  Target
607 607  
SDMX 3-0-0 SECTION 6 FINAL-1.0_en_295af259.jpg
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.helena
Size
... ... @@ -1,1 +1,0 @@
1 -57.7 KB
Content
SDMX 3-0-0 SECTION 6 FINAL-1.0_en_4ec4bb31.gif
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.helena
Size
... ... @@ -1,1 +1,0 @@
1 -1.4 KB
Content
SDMX 3-0-0 SECTION 6 FINAL-1.0_en_59eee18f.gif
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.helena
Size
... ... @@ -1,1 +1,0 @@
1 -851 bytes
Content
SDMX 3-0-0 SECTION 6 FINAL-1.0_en_6dbf7f.gif
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.helena
Size
... ... @@ -1,1 +1,0 @@
1 -1.1 KB
Content
SDMX 3-0-0 SECTION 6 FINAL-1.0_en_a3215c79.jpg
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.helena
Size
... ... @@ -1,1 +1,0 @@
1 -30.6 KB
Content
SDMX 3-0-0 SECTION 6 FINAL-1.0_en_ab51b44a.jpg
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.helena
Size
... ... @@ -1,1 +1,0 @@
1 -28.1 KB
Content
SDMX 3-0-0 SECTION 6 FINAL-1.0_en_dbe68698.gif
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.helena
Size
... ... @@ -1,1 +1,0 @@
1 -863 bytes
Content